Home Malware Cleaner Screenshot 1Home Malware Cleaner should be considered to be anything but hygienic, since SpywareRemove.com malware researchers have traced Home Malware Cleaner’s past through disreputable scamware like Malware Protection Center and all the way back to evidence of browser hijacks, attacks against PC security software and fraudulent security features. Even though Home Malware Cleaner has the appearance of a polished and reputable anti-malware scanner, there isn’t a single virus or Trojan in the world that Home Malware Cleaner could detect or remove, and system analysis information from Home Malware Cleaner should always be considered inaccurate. If your PC is under attack by Home Malware Cleaner, you should consider expelling Home Malware Cleaner with a legitimate security product or anti-malware scanner, along with any Trojans or other PC threats that may have been installed with Home Malware Cleaner in the first place.

Home Malware Cleaner – a Clone of Fake Anti-Malware Functions That Shares Its Ancestors’ Taint


Home Malware Cleaner uses an official-looking interface that claims to offer defense against viruses, spyware and other types of malicious software, but, unlike a real anti-malware scanner, Home Malware Cleaner isn’t coded to detect or remove any kind of PC threat. Although Home Malware Cleaner will displays its fair share of alerts and scanner results, the information that’s contained therein will always portray fake infection notifications and other issues that aren’t actually in existence on your PC. Because its value as a security product is nonexistent, Home Malware Cleaner’s alerts, warnings and other efforts at communication should always be ignored, particularly since they may lead you to perform unwittingly self-destructive acts against your computer.

Beyond its fake anti-malware features, Home Malware Cleaner is also guilty of being a clone of other rogue anti-malware products from the FakeVimes family that use the same appearance and basic functions. Leaving Your Computer Sparklingly Clean from a Distinct Lack of Home Malware Cleaner


Even with appropriate anti-malware software on your PC, deleting Home Malware Cleaner may be difficult due to secondary functions that SpySpywareRemove.com malware experts have observed from Home Malware Cleaner and other members of its family. Some other attacks that you may notice while trying to delete Home Malware Cleaner consist of:
  • The appearance of random trash files on your hard drive. These files aren’t harmful, but will continue to appear due to Home Malware Cleaner creating them to label as fake infections.
  • Programs that are blocked without your permission, with or without the occurrence of additional fake error messages.
  • Browser hijacks that redirect your browser to unsafe sites or away from safe ones.

However, once Home Malware Cleaner is disabled via Safe Mode or other methods, removing Home Malware Cleaner with any appropriate anti-malware program should be a fairly easy task for anyone.

Technical Details

File System Modifications

  • The following files were created in the system:
    # File Name Detection Count
    1 %AllUsersProfile%\[5 RANDOM CHARACTERS]\HM[RANDOM CHARACTERS].exe 183
    2 %AllUsersProfile%\Application Data\[6 RANDOM CHARACTERS]\HM[RANDOM CHARACTERS]_[NUMBERS].exe 162
    3 %AllUsersProfile%\[6 RANDOM CHARACTERS]\HM[RANDOM CHARACTERS]_[NUMBERS].exe 155
    4 %ALLUSERSPROFILE%\ Application Data\ cac25b\ HMcac_8001.exe 12
    5 %ALLUSERSPROFILE%\ d1e546\ HMd1e_8020.exe 12
    6 %Programs%\Home Malware Cleaner.lnk N/A
    7 %Desktop%\Home Malware Cleaner.lnk N/A
    8 %StartMenu%\Home Malware Cleaner.lnk N/A
    9 %CommonAppData%\[RANDOM]\ASE.ico N/A
    10 %CommonAppData%\[RANDOM]\[RANDOM].exe N/A
    11 %CommonAppData%\[RANDOM]\[RANDOM].cfg N/A
    12 %AppData%\Home Malware Cleaner\Instructions.ini N/A
    13 %AppData%\Home Malware Cleaner\ScanDisk_.exe N/A
    14 %AppData%\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Quick Launch\Home Malware Cleaner.lnk N/A
